When I was around 6 or 7, my father and his uncles who lived next door to us planted some vegetables in both our back gardens. Was a nice sized bit of land so they went for carrots and potatoes, though the uncles planted more carrots. Grew quite nicely and all seemed well until Uncle Jack -- not the drummer, that one was Mom's uncle; Dad's Uncle Jack was the one into puttering around the house and garden and could sew as well as a tailor on his mom's or sister's antique Singer sewing machine -- noticed the rows looked rather thin, as if somebody had been helping themselves. Which was very likely as we did have a few lazy hangashores who only needed to ask not steal and teenagers who'd do that sort of thing for a lark. Anyway, they stayed up one night and watched the garden.
Turns out the thieves were two pet rabbits that belonged to some neigbours down the lane and across the road from us. They kept getting out of their pens and going on raids of all the gardens in the area. Mostly everyone else on the hill just planted flowers and trees so they probably thought our little veggie garden was Paradise, an all you can eat buffet. The neighbours did corral their bunnies and apologize but the damage was done, only a couple small bunches of carrots left and not many potatoes either, though I think something else got most of those. Probably Norwegian rats, was nearly overrun with those back then, they'd come up from off the boats and nest wherever they thought the pickings were like to be good. Cats and dogs were practically run ragged hunting them down. Vicious things, nearly as big as some full grown cats. Lost more than one rat trap to a half dead or only stunned Norwegian water rat dragging it off wherever they were hiding.

@gill Yes, it was really quite obvious that his Doctor should be a poodle with an extra long scarf. Trick was getting the colours as close as possible. Poodle defaulted to white, so it must be a brown poodle and a multicoloured scarf. So far, so good. Except the brown went other places than just the dog. A little in the scarf pattern wouldn't hurt, but no, it had to go on the Tardis too. :sigh: Have yet to figure out how to get any version of Stable Diffusion to colour inside the lines when told to.
